Overview

Steel structural components are prefabricated parts used to assemble frameworks in construction and industrial projects. They range from beams, columns, and trusses to custom-fabricated connectors. Their popularity stems from steel’s exceptional mechanical properties, including tensile strength and ductility, which allow for designs that withstand heavy loads and dynamic forces. Modern manufacturing techniques, such as CNC cutting and robotic welding, ensure precision in these components. They are often galvanized or painted to enhance corrosion resistance, extending service life in harsh environments like coastal areas or chemical plants.

Structure and Working Principle

Steel components derive their functionality from geometric design and material science. I-beams, for example, distribute weight efficiently due to their cross-sectional shape, while hollow sections reduce weight without compromising strength. Connections (bolted or welded) transfer forces between parts, ensuring structural stability. Advanced simulations (e.g., finite element analysis) optimize component designs for specific stress points. Modularity is another key advantage; standardized parts enable rapid assembly and scalability in projects like warehouses or transmission towers.

Key Features

Durability is a hallmark of steel components, with lifespans exceeding 50 years when properly maintained. Their fire resistance can be enhanced with intumescent coatings, making them safer than alternatives in high-temperature settings. Sustainability is increasingly prioritized—recycled steel accounts for up to 90% of material in some components, reducing environmental impact. Additionally, lightweight designs minimize transportation costs and foundation requirements.

Application Areas

In construction, steel frames dominate high-rise buildings and industrial facilities due to their speed of erection. Infrastructure projects, such as bridges and railway stations, rely on steel for its ability to span long distances without intermediate supports. Heavy machinery and energy sectors use specialized components like turbine housings or offshore platform legs, where strength-to-weight ratios are critical. Pre-engineered steel buildings (PEBs) are also gaining traction for warehouses and airports.

Maintenance and Precautions

Regular inspections for rust, cracks, or bolt loosening are essential. Corrosion-prone areas require touch-ups with protective coatings. In seismic zones, components should be designed for flexibility to absorb vibrations. Improper welding can introduce weak points; thus, certified procedures (e.g., AWS D1.1) must be followed. Storage should keep components dry and elevated to prevent ground moisture damage.

B2B Procurement Guide

Buyers should verify mill test certificates to confirm steel grades (e.g., ASTM A36 or S355JR). Custom fabrication demands detailed drawings and tolerances. Bulk orders (10+ tons) often qualify for discounts, but lead times vary by complexity. Partner with suppliers offering CAD/CAM support for design optimization. For international procurement, factor in shipping costs and tariffs—local fabricators may be cost-effective for large volumes.
